Aviation: Compensation

(asked on 10th October 2022) - View Source

Question to the Department for Transport:

To ask the Secretary of State for Transport, if she will introduce a new compensation regime for domestic flights through primary legislation.


Answered by
Katherine Fletcher Portrait
Katherine Fletcher
This question was answered on 18th October 2022

The Government remains committed to protecting the rights of passengers when travelling by air.

The Aviation Consumer Policy Reform Consultation aimed to collect views on ways to bolster air passenger rights. It explored a range of consumer policy reforms, including additional powers for the Civil Aviation Authority, and reform to compensation for delayed domestic UK flights. We are currently conducting a comprehensive review and analysis of responses and will set out next steps shortly.

The Department for Transport has held discussions with the Devolved Administrations ahead of publication of the Aviation Consumer Policy Reform Consultation and will continue engagement going forward.
